An overview of this role
As a Demo Architect , you'll help GitLab teams and customers get hands-on with our platform faster and with less friction. This role reports to the Senior Director of our Solutions Architecture Center of Excellence , with day-to-day partnership from the current team lead. You'll build and improve the tools, applications, and infrastructure that support pre-sales demos, workshops, trials, and internal test environments across the field.
What makes this role unique is its mix of software engineering, infrastructure, and customer-facing collaboration. You'll work like an engineer for much of the role, while also partnering with Solutions Architects, Account Executives, Customer Success, and others to make sure what we build is practical, usable, and aligned to how the field sells.
What you'll do
Build and maintain tools, applications, and workflows that support demos, workshops, trials, and internal test environments.
Expand the Demo Architect Portal to improve automation, self-service, and scalability for field teams and partners.
Provision and support infrastructure that enables hands-on customer experiences across GitLab.com , demo instances, and internal environments.
Collaborate with Solutions Architects, Account Executives, Customer Success, Marketing, Revenue Operations, UX, and Engineering to understand needs and deliver practical technical solutions.
Learn and document go-to-market workflows (e.g., how teams run demos/workshops/trials) and automate the steps that waste time.
Create technical workshop assets and enablement content that support pre-sales and technical selling for individual contributors.
Advise on sales opportunities when specialized technical demo support or custom solutions are needed.
Improve the presenter experience by reducing manual setup work and making demo workflows easier to use and repeat.
Support internal teams that rely on demo or test infrastructure, helping keep those environments available and useful.
Troubleshoot urgent demo/workshop environment issues under pressure and communicate status clearly to stakeholders.
